Egypt achieved a historic triumph, this Sunday (21), by beating New Zealand 3-1, in Vancouver. It was the first Egyptian victory in the history of World Cups, after nine games and four appearances.
New Zealand opened the scoring with Surman in the first half. But, in the final stage, Egypt improved and reached the turnaround thanks to goals from Salah and Trezeguet (namesake of the world champion with France in 1998).
It was also the first victory in group G of the World Cup, which had only three draws until then. With this, Egypt took the isolated lead, reaching four points and practically guaranteeing a place in the knockout stages.

New Zealand surprises Egypt in the first half
Even before opening the scoring, the New Zealanders already had control of the match in Vancouver. In the sixth minute, after a counterattack, Singh received the ball at the edge of the area and filled the ball, but the ball went to the right of the goal.
Seven minutes later, another arrival from the All Whites. After winning the split with Hany, Stamenic threw it to Just, who hit and stopped in Shobeir’s defense.
After trying so hard, New Zealand scored on the next corner. Tim Payne took the shot with precision and found the head of 1.90m defender Surman. He tested hard, with no chance for the Egyptian goalkeeper.
Egypt’s best chance came in the 26th minute. After Ashour’s play, Marmoush received the ball in the area and hit the goal, but goalkeeper Crocombe worked twice to avoid the goal.
Zico leads Egypt’s comeback
Pressured by the fans, who were the noisy majority in the stadium, the Egyptian team came back much stronger for the second half. With just a few seconds, Salah had already made Crocombe work to avoid the equalizer.
In the 9th minute, Surman scored “another goal”. This is because the New Zealand defender avoided a clear chance from the Egyptian Zico, blocking the shot that would have gone into the goal with his knee.
Four minutes later, there was no way. With the name of a star in honor of Flamengo’s idol, Zico took advantage of a great cross from Hany, rose well and headed strong, past goalkeeper Crocombe.
At 21 minutes of the final stage, the top scorer became a waiter. The star Salah brought the ball in from the right, created a beautiful link with Zico and played with skill, moving the archer to turn the score around.
The goal that killed the game came in the 36th minute. Trezeguet, who had recently joined, scored another header in the game, taking advantage of a corner taken by Salah.
Group situation and upcoming games
The Egyptian victory was the first victory in four games in group G of the World Cup. With this, of course, Egypt takes the lead alone, adding four points in two rounds.
After two draws, Belgium and Iran have two points, while New Zealand has one. In other words, in the final round, everyone will arrive with a chance of qualifying.
Egypt faces Iran in Seattle, while New Zealand continues in Vancouver to face Belgium. The games will be simultaneous, midnight from Friday (26) to Saturday (27).
